Argonaut Gold Inc. (TSX:AR) (the "Company", "Argonaut Gold" or "Argonaut") is
pleased to announce its financial and operating results for the first quarter
ended March 31, 2014. All dollar amounts are expressed in United States dollars
unless otherwise specified.

CEO Commentary

Pete Dougherty, President and CEO of Argonaut Gold, stated, "In terms of
production at El Castillo, the mining rate increased during the quarter with the
addition of new equipment. We also saw an increase in utilization of the west
side conveying unit. The strip ratio increased during the quarter as a result of
commencing the final push back on the northern portion of the pit. Though we had
a higher strip ratio, the grade reconciled positively at 0.34 g/t compared to
expectations of 0.32 g/t. With March achieving an 18% increase over production
from January, we anticipate continual improvement at El Castillo in terms of
production. Our production guidance is 90,000 to 100,000 gold ounces at a cash
cost per gold ounce sold of $775 to $800 at El Castillo in 2014 (cash cost per
gold ounce sold is a non-IFRS measure, see note below).


At La Colorado, we have added to the crushing capacity by installing another
cone crusher. We aim to increase our crushing rates, and thus production at the
La Colorada mine. In regards to the mine plan, the processing of old heap leach
pad material is expected to have positive results on the La Colorada production.
Over the next two years, the mine plan will incorporate approximately four
million tonnes of this material at 0.35 g/t gold and 11.2 g/t silver, with
recoveries estimated at 50% gold and 30% silver. Current mining rates of 51,000
tonnes per day are sufficient to meet production guidance with the inclusion of
the old heap leach material. At La Colorada, the guidance is for 45,000 to
50,000 ounces of gold equivalent production at a cash cost of $640 to $665 per
gold ounce sold (cash cost per gold ounce sold is a non-IFRS measure, see note
below).


Overall, the Company confirms its 2014 guidance of 135,000 to 150,000 gold
equivalent ounces of production at a cash cost per gold ounce sold of $750 to
$775 (cash cost per gold ounce sold is a non-IFRS measure, see note below).


Magino heap leach testing results are encouraging and more work will be done in
regards to how these results may impact the project. We will continue to work on
the permitting and expect to submit permit applications by the end of the year.


At San Antonio, we received notification that our appeal to reverse the decision
on the 2012 MIA was rejected. While we would have liked to see a different
result in the ruling, we will continue to pursue permits on both a community and
social front, as well as via an appeal of the recent legal ruling. Meanwhile, we
will continue to pursue an amendment to the municipal zoning plan in an effort
to zone the project for 100% industrial use. The Company continues to believe in
the merits and benefits of the project to all stakeholders, and continues to
enjoy broad community support.


Finally at San Agustin, the exploration team has completed 13,000 metres of
drilling. This work was focused on fill-in and step-out drilling of the known
historic resource area. Drill results confirmed the continuity and grade of
mineralization. In addition, the deposit remains open in all directions. A Phase
II drill program is in progress and the Company expects to complete an
additional 10,000 metres of RC drilling in approximately 100 holes. We are very
pleased to have this exciting project in our portfolio. We expect to release an
initial resource on the project in the late third quarter or early fourth
quarter, followed by a PEA to be completed by the end of the year."


Financial Results - First Quarter 2014

During the first quarter of 2014, revenue was $39.1 million from gold sales of
28,639 ounces, compared to $43.1 million from gold sales of 25,441 ounces in the
first quarter of 2013. Cash cost per gold ounce sold in the quarter was $731,
compared to $594 in the same period of the prior year reflecting a decrease in
capitalized stripping (cash cost per gold ounce sold is a non-IFRS measure, see
note below).


During the first quarter of 2014, gross profit was $8.0 million, compared to
$21.0 million in the first quarter of 2013. During the quarter, profit from
operations was $4.6 million, compared to $17.2 million in the same period of the
prior year. Net income for the period was $2.8 million, or $0.02 per basic
share, versus $11.6 million, or $0.08 per basic share, in the first quarter of
2013.


Cash and cash equivalents was $59.7 million at March 31, 2014. Cash spent
towards capital expenditures in the first quarter were $13.6 million, primarily
spent on capitalized stripping, mining equipment purchases and equipment
overhauls.

Summary of Production Results at El Castillo

Total tonnes mined increased by 27% for the first quarter 2014 over first
quarter 2013. The ounces loaded to the pads in the first quarter 2014 increased
by 11% over first quarter 2013.


Gold production of 21,976 ounces in the first quarter of 2014 was 5% lower
compared to the first quarter of 2013; production rates are improving and
expected to increase in the second half of the year. 2014 guidance at El
Castillo is for 90,000 to 100,000 gold ounces.


The strip ratio of waste to ore increased in the first quarter of 2014 to 1.14
compared to 0.95 in the first quarter of 2013, reflecting a push back on the
north side of the pit.

Summary of Production Results at La Colorada

Total tonnes mined increased by 6% for the first quarter 2014 over first quarter
2013. There were 10,812 ounces placed on the pad in the first quarter of 2014,
compared to 5,142 ounces placed on the pad in the first quarter of 2013 (an
increase of 110%).


First quarter production in 2014 of 8,792 GEO's was an increase of 33% over
first quarter 2013 production of 6,598 GEO's. We anticipate gold equivalent
ounce production rising to 45,000 to 50,000 ounces for 2014 as we ramp up
crushing capacity and mine higher grade ore.


San Antonio

The Company continues to pursue approvals for its San Antonio project. As
previously disclosed, on August 2, 2012 the Secretary for Environment and
Natural Resources denied the MIA authorization for the Company's San Antonio
project due to municipal zoning incompatibility over a portion of the site.


In response, the Company appealed the determination in connection with its MIA
before the Mexican Federal Court. The Company's appeal regarding the MIA
authorization was denied by the Mexican Federal Court on April 10, 2014. The
Company has appealed the decision of the Mexican Federal Court and is also
working with the local municipality to seek an amendment to the municipal zoning
plan for the change of use of land permit required.


San Agustin Drilling Resource Update

Argonaut Gold has now completed a total of 13,000 metres of the 15,000 metre
Phase I drill program at San Agustin. The RC drilling includes 12,000 metres of
drilling and approximately 119 holes. This program has provided positive results
and the mineral system remains open. A Phase II RC drill program of
approximately 10,000 metres has commenced.


The objective of the Phase I drill program was to enhance our understanding of
the deposit and confirm the known historic resource area. Drilling is now
completed on an approximate 50 metre drill pattern. This drilling confirmed the
continuity and grade of resource area. Phase II drilling is designed to step-out
beyond the current drill areas and test areas of recognized geologic potential.
The following table is divided into in-fill and extension drilling. Extension
drilling to date has expanded the resource area upwards of 250 metres to the
northwest with this area remaining a priority target area for Phase II drilling.


Total drilling for Phase I and Phase II will total approximately 25,000 metres
in approximately 250 holes. Visit http://www.argonautgold.com for complete
results of San Agustin drill holes from 2014.


Tom Burkhart, Vice President of Exploration for Argonaut Gold, said, "The
Company's drill program at San Agustin is confirming the strength and continuity
of mineralization within the known historic resource area. Importantly our work
supports the potential to confirm and significantly expand the size of the
resource through additional drilling."

Capital Expenditures for 2014

The Company plans on investing a total of between $43 million and $63 million on
capital expenditures and exploration initiatives in 2014. Major capital
expenditures in 2014 are expected to include approximately $15 million at El
Castillo (including mining service company expenditures and capitalized
stripping of $4 million), $13 million at La Colorada (predominately capitalized
stripping of $9 million), $3 million at San Agustin, $4 million at Magino, and
$3 to $23 million at San Antonio, depending on permitting. Exploration
expenditures in 2014 are expected to amount to approximately $5 million.

Non-IFRS Measures

The Company has included a non-IFRS measure for "Cash cost per gold ounce sold"
in this press release to supplement its financial statements which are presented
in accordance with International Financial Reporting Standards ("IFRS"). Cash
cost per gold ounce sold is equal to production costs less silver sales divided
by gold ounces sold. The Company believes that this measure provides investors
with an improved ability to evaluate the performance of the Company. Non-IFRS
measures do not have any standardized meaning prescribed under IFRS. Therefore
they may not be comparable to similar measures employed by other companies. The
data is intended to provide additional information and should not be considered
in isolation or as a substitute for measures of performance prepared in
accordance with IFRS. Please see the management's discussion and analysis
("MD&A") for full disclosure on non-IFRS measures.

About Argonaut Gold

Argonaut Gold is a Canadian gold company engaged in exploration, mine
development and production activities. Its primary assets are the production
stage El Castillo mine in Durango, Mexico, and the La Colorada mine in Sonora,
Mexico. Advanced exploration stage projects include the San Antonio project in
Baja California Sur, Mexico, and the Magino project in Ontario, Canada. The
recently acquired San Agustin project is the primary exploration target for
Argonaut in 2014. The Company also has several exploration stage projects, all
of which are located in North America.
